Corpse of man whose wife, sister were abducted found in bush

The corpse of a man, Hussaini Lawal, whose wife, Amina, and sister, Hajara, were abducted by bandits in Janjala community in Kagarko LGA of Kaduna State has been found in a bush in the area.

City & Crime had reported that bandits on Tuesday night raided three communities, killed three people and abducted 16 others.

A relative of the deceased, Dauda Hafuza, who spoke with our reporter through telephone on Thursday, said the man’s corpse was found in the early hours of Thursday near a stream close to a forest.

He explained that the victim had escaped with bullet wounds after bandits invaded his house in Taka-Lafiya village near Janjala and abducted his wife and his sister.

The Madaki of Janjala, Samaila Babangida, who confirmed the recovery of the corpse, said, “They brought the corpse Janjala and I reached out to his relations in Taka-Lafiya who came and buried it.” 

There was no response from the spokesman of the state police command over the development at the time of filing this report.
